About this course

This course meets the industry's growing demand for leaders who can manage diverse teams and engage in successful cross-cultural negotiations. By combining theoretical knowledge with practical applications, learners will develop critical skills such as intercultural communication, empathy, and conflict resolution. Upon completion, learners will be equipped with the necessary tools to handle delicate negotiations in various cultural contexts, enhancing their leadership abilities and contributing significantly to their organizations' success. This certification serves as a testament to one's commitment to professional development and adaptability in an ever-changing global landscape.

Course details

• Cross-Cultural Communication: Understanding Cultural Differences & Similarities
• Effective Communication Strategies in Cross-Cultural Negotiations
• Preparing for Cross-Cultural Negotiations: Research, Planning & Adaptation
• Building Trust & Rapport in Cross-Cultural Negotiations
• Managing Conflict & Emotions in Cross-Cultural Contexts
• Leveraging Power & Influence in Cross-Cultural Negotiations
• Negotiating Ethically & Responsibly Across Cultures
• Navigating Legal & Compliance Considerations in Cross-Cultural Negotiations
• Case Studies & Real-World Applications in Cross-Cultural Negotiations
